Teilinger USA's Q3 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2015, Teilinger USA held 5 positions worth $2.35M, down 76% from $9.76M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 100% of the portfolio.

Teilinger USA withdrew a net $6.75M in Q3 2015, closing 3 positions and reducing 1 holding. Its most notable exit was Energy Transfer Partners L.p., an estimated $3.74M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Energy at 47% of assets, up from 38%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Utilities.

Against the trend, Teilinger USA opened a new position in Genesis Energy worth $1.11M.
